- Tilapia is a freshwater fish commodities that have economical value. Tilapia (Oreochromis sp.) is relatively easily to cultivated and has several advantages among others rapid growh rate, high tolerance to the environment and resistant to disease. Intensive fish cultivated using high stocking density and feed doses that are too high, causing to decreased growth, survival rate and water quality. One of the efforts is to use technology that combines and aquaculture with plants. Aquaponics is the combination of aquaculture and hydroponics which aims to preserve fish and plants in the interconnected system. This study aims to determine the density of red tilapia fish using aquaponics technology. The study was conducted for 35 days, starting from February to March 2015 in Faculty of Agriculture Laboratory. Fish samples used 1 fish/L, 3 fish/L and 5 fish/L by using a completely randomized design (CRD) with three treatments and three reiteration. The result showed that treatment with a density 1 fish/L gives the best results for the survival rate 100%±0,00, specific growth rate 2,03%±0,08 and feed convertion ratio 1,33%±0,09.
